The Corporate Legal team at Thomson Reuters is seeking to hire a senior sales manager for Canada. This role will be responsible for driving revenue growth in all of the legal products. You will work directly with our customers and internal teams to understand their needs and requirements and propose solutions using the full portfolio of legal products. In this role you will also oversee the activities of a group of Account Executives who are similarly focused on growing revenues within their respective territories.
About The Role:
In this role as a Senior Sales Manager, you will:
- Manage a team of account executives who sell legal products and services to customers in your territory
- Develop a strategy to grow market share and increase customer adoption across all product lines in your territory
- Provide regular updates to management on sales activity, pipeline health, and forecasting
- Understand industry trends and developments and use them as selling points when speaking with potential clients
- Collaborate with cross-functional teams (pre-sales support, professional services, customer success) to ensure outstanding customer experience and high contract conversion rates
- Contribute to the development of new products and enhancements by providing feedback based on customer interactions
- Stay abreast of competitive landscape and market trends and communicate these insights to internal stakeholders
- Maintain accurate records related to sales activity, customer information, and market trends
- Participate in trade shows, conferences, and other networking events to promote the company’s offerings and build relationships with potential customers
About You
You're a fit for the role of Senior Sales Manager if your background includes:
- Minimum 5 years of relevant work experience required
- Minimum of 3 years of relevant sales leadership experience
- Strong understanding of legal technology and related markets
- Proven track record of successful sales performance
- Excellent communication and interpersonal skills
- Ability to manage multiple projects simultaneously and prioritize tasks effectively
-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ite (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Outlook)
- Experience working with CRM software (e.g., Salesforce)

About Us
Thomson Reuters informs the way forward by bringing together the trusted content and technology that people and organizations need to make the right decisions. We serve professionals across legal, tax, accounting, compliance, government, and media. Our products combine highly specialized software and insights to empower professionals with the data, intelligence, and solutions needed to make informed decisions, and to help institutions in their pursuit of justice, truth, and transparency. Reuters, part of Thomson Reuters, is a world leading provider of trusted journalism and news.
We are powered by the talents of 26,000 employees across more than 70 countries, where everyone has a chance to contribute and grow professionally in flexible work environments.
